Sky High Fee for sending money :


In Banking the most alarming factor to send money to another country is their high transaction fee. Later i realized  they really needed it , because they have to operate a huge HR to operate one single transaction. Recently the transaction fee between Bitcoin wallets is lowered. Bitcoin is the least expensive approach to send worldwide installments. As somebody who works on the web, I've attempted a wide range of installment choices and Bitcoin is the least expensive. When I send bitcoins, I pay the need mining charge that is so minimal and it depends on the number of transaction , not my amount .

Some Examples (Collected)
Worldwide bank wire: between $22-$50 (1-3 days)
Paypal: 2.9% or more $0.30, 2.5% remote trade expenses (considers 3-5 days to store)
Settlements: Between 9-13% (typically takes 5 minutes)
Visas: 3-5% for dealers, for buyers (expecting you pay on time) yearly expense $0-$200, 2.5% outside cash transformation, numerous expansion charges and premium charges for late installment.
Other e-wallets: There are a wide range of e-wallets yet exchanges can go from 2-4% on remote trade charges, a % or settled expense for sending and getting installments and 1-5% for stores/withdrawals into your bank.

56  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/ What is smart contact ? For New comers !! on: February 05, 2018, 07:31:21 PM
When i was researching on Ethereum , i got this keyword. So i decided to write an overview for the newbie.

Actually Smart Contract is a type of  self-executing contract that is intended to authorize the terms of an agreement made between two parties. Terms of the contract are recorded in a computer language. It is  a computer protocol intended to digitally facilitate, verify, or enforce the negotiation or performance of a contract. It eliminates the third party

The point of smart contracts is to -
1. Encourage the trading of cash, or anything of significant worth.
2. While likewise lessening costs related with the arrangement of a contract e.g. legitimate charges.


For instance, If Rahim needed to go into a contractual agreement with Sara for the offer of a house, typically, the two people would look for the assistance of a real estate agent or a legal advisor keeping in mind the end goal to frame a contract.

On the Ethereum blockchain - A notable utilization of smart contracts can be found , where they are coordinated into decentralized applications (DApps).
